Generation of the Baryon Asymmetry of the Universe within the Left--Right Symmetric Model
J. -M. Frère, L. Houart, J. M. Moreno, J. Orloff, M. Tytgat
Abstract
Fermions scattering off first-order phase transition bubbles, in the framework of SU(2)L SU(2)R U(1) models, may generate the Baryon Asymmetry of the Universe (BAU), either at the LR-symmetry-breaking scale, or at the weak scale. In the latter case, the baryon asymmetry of the Universe is related to CP violation in the K0-- K0 system.
